I run from source but I'm able to record with 100% reliability over
firewire. It probably should be noted that I only use the old analog
channels (below 100) and not any of the digital channels.
 00:0c.0 FireWire (IEEE 1394): VIA Technologies, Inc. IEEE 1394 Host
Controller (rev 46)
 I have libiec61883 installed (no idea the version, its all source and
relatively old)
libraw1394-1.2.0
libavc1394-0.5.0
gscanbus-0.7.1
kernel 2.6.8.1 <http://2.6.8.1>
 You shouldn't need all of that but its working so I haven't done any house
cleaning. I do remember that I had to change my node ID manually when I
first started using MythTV with firewire, but that seems to have been fixed.
